Would the game run on the new Apple's M4/M4 Pro chip?
I really doubt it.
There is no Mac support for this game.
Even if you emulate everything I doubt you would be happy with the results.
It's not only that an intel/amd CPU needs to be emulated (which slows the M4 down), I'm pretty sure the GPU part is completely incompatible with the game's system requirement as it seems to have no builtin DirectX support at all which then needs to be emulated as well (way further slow down) - if there is even any software which would do this.
